Hello! I just ran the Surf City Marathon. You know, nothing like running 26.2 miles to get ready for the Super Bowl feast. Here’s my race recap / results / random rambling because I’m delirious and enjoying a bev.

I finally had a good race! I needed this so bad. I didn’t PR, but I felt strong – even at the end.

1. I went back to my tried and true pre-race food = rice with tons of salt and soy sauce. I also drank a lot of everything yesterday – seltzer, water, vitawater…

2. This morning = bagel and coffee.

3. Race time!

Surf City Marathon:
It was a little warmer than I would have liked, but a great day for a race! I saw a lot of my Sole Runner friends and it was really good to see familiar faces and get some high-fives! It’s been too long since I’ve run with them. I miss them.
Surf City Marathon results = 3:50:42

This was the first race since probably last May that I felt good at the end. It’s also the first one that I didn’t hate myself for signing up for the full versus the half around mile 17.

I think the reason is I took hydration and fueling a little back to being a little more disciplined again. I used to be better about it and just got lazy. My legs are still not fresh, but considering that – I felt great.
But I’m still glad it is over and now I can just eat!
